实现Redis三主三从集群的步骤
为了实现Redis的三主三从集群,我们需要按照以下步骤逐步进行操作。下面是整个流程的简单概览:
步骤 | 操作 |
---|---|
1. | 配置主节点 |
2. | 启动主节点 |
3. | 配置从节点 |
4. | 启动从节点 |
5. | 配置复制 |
6. | 验证集群配置 |
现在我们逐步解释每个步骤需要做什么,以及相应的代码和注释。
1. 配置主节点
首先,我们需要配置主节点。
在Redis的安装目录下,找到主节点的配置文件redis.conf,并进行编辑。主要的配置项如下:
port 6379 # 设置主节点的端口号为6379
daemonize yes # 后台启动Redis服务
cluster-enabled yes # 开启集群模式
cluster-config-file nodes.conf # 集群配置文件的路径
cluster-node-timeout 5000 # 设置节点超时时间为5000毫秒
appendonly yes # 开启AOF持久化
2. 启动主节点
完成主节点的配置后,我们需要启动主节点。在终端中执行以下命令:
redis-server redis.conf
3. 配置从节点
接下来,我们配置从节点。在Redis的安装目录下,复制一份主节点的配置文件,并进行编辑。修改以下配置项:
port 6380 # 设置从节点的端口号为6380
daemonize yes # 后台启动Redis服务
cluster-enabled yes # 开启集群模式
cluster-config-file nodes.conf # 集群配置文件的路径
cluster-node-timeout 5000 # 设置节点超时时间为5000毫秒
appendonly yes # 开启AOF持久化
4. 启动从节点
完成从节点的配置后,我们需要启动从节点。在终端中执行以下命令:
redis-server redis.conf
5. 配置复制
现在我们需要配置主从复制。在终端中执行以下命令:
redis-cli -p 6379 # 进入主节点的命令行
CLUSTER MEET 127.0.0.1 6380 # 将从节点添加到主节点的集群中
重复以上步骤,将其他从节点也添加到主节点的集群中。
6. 验证集群配置
最后,我们需要验证集群配置是否正常。在终端中执行以下命令:
redis-cli -p 6379 # 进入主节点的命令行
CLUSTER NODES # 查看集群中的节点信息
如果一切正常,你应该能够看到主节点和从节点的相关信息。
至此,我们已经完成了Redis三主三从集群的搭建。
以上是每个步骤需要做的事情,以及相应的代码和注释。通过按照这些步骤逐步操作,你将能够成功搭建Redis的三主三从集群。祝你好运!